The QNAP QXG-5G1T-111C is a network expansion card that brings 5 Gb Ethernet speed to any computer or QNAP NAS that has a PCIe 3.0 x1 slot. By adding this card, you can move large media projects, virtual machine images, or daily backups much faster than standard Gigabit connections allow.

Installation is straightforward. A single RJ45 port sits on the bracket, and the card works over existing Cat 5e cabling, so most offices and home labs will not need to run new wires. QNAP includes three brackets—a pre-installed low-profile version, a full-height option, and a special bracket for select QNAP NAS models—so the card fits neatly into compact desktops, workstations, and rack-mount enclosures alike.

The Marvell AQtion AQC111C controller inside the card negotiates 5 G, 2.5 G, 1 G, and 100 Mb speeds automatically. It runs smoothly on Windows, Linux, and QTS, allowing mixed-platform environments to upgrade with minimal effort. Highlights:
  • PCIe 3.0 x1 interface installs in most desktops and NAS systems
  • One RJ45 Ethernet port that supports 5 G, 2.5 G, 1 G, and 100 Mb connections
  • Marvell AQtion AQC111C controller for reliable multi-gig throughput
  • Works with Cat 5e cables, avoiding costly rewiring
  • Includes low-profile, full-height, and QNAP-specific brackets for flexible mounting
  • Compatible with Windows, Linux, and QTS operating systems
  • Limited two-year warranty from QNAP
